ORDER Sua Sponte Reconsidering The Portion Of The March 16, 2016 Order Dismissing With Prejudice The Security Deposit Claims Against Defendant Hawaii Affordable Properties, Inc. re 47 . This Court HEREBY RECONSIDERS the 3/16/16 Order ins ofar as the portion of the order dismissing the security deposit claims against HAPI with prejudice is VACATED. All other portions of the 3/16/16 Order remain in effect and are not altered by the instant Order in any way.Plaintiffs' security deposit claims against HAPI in Count I of the Third Amended Complaint are properly before this Court at this time and will be addressed on the merits in connection with the parties' pending motions for summary judgment. This Court finds that th e issues relevant to the security deposit claims against HAPI were sufficiently briefed in connection with the motions for summary judgment 220 , 221 , 223 , 225 , and no further briefing is necessary. The parties' motions for summary judgment have been taken under advisement, and no further briefing will be considered unless the filing party obtains leave from this Court before filing any additional materials regarding any of the motions for summary judgment. Signed by JUDGE LESLIE E. KOBAYASHI on 9/24/2018. (cib, )

ORDER GRANTING IN PART AND DENYING IN PART PLAINTIFF'S MOTION TO DISMISS SUIT WITHOUT PREJUDICE re 74 Motion to Dismiss. Signed by JUDGE LESLIE E. KOBAYASHI on 09/30/2016. -- Plaintiff's Motion to Dismiss Suit Without Prejudice, filed August 15, 2016, is HEREBY GRANTED IN PART AND DENIED IN PART. Plaintiff's Motion is GRANTED insofar as the Representative Claims and Plaintiff's Lease Termination Claim are HEREBY DISMISSED WITHOUT PRE JUDICE to the re-filing of those claims in a new case. Plaintiff's Motion is DENIED insofar as all of the other claims which remained at issue in this case after this Courts March 16, 2016 order are HEREBY DISMISSED WITH PREJUDICE. There being no remaining claims in this case, this Court DIRECTS the Clerk's Office to enter final judgment and close the case on October 21, 2016, unless any party files a motion for reconsideration of the instant Order by October 17,2016. ORDER GRANTING IN PART AND DENYING IN PART DEFENDANTS OFFICE OF HOUSING & COMMUNITY DEVELOPMENT, COUNTY OF HAWAIIS MOTION TO DISMISS; AND GRANTING IN PART AND DENYING IN PART DEFENDANT HAWAII AFFORDABLE PROPERTIES, INC.'S SUBSTANTIVE JOINDER re 4 Motion to Dismiss for Failure to State a Claim; re 9 Motion for Joinder. Signed by JUDGE LESLIE E. KOBAYASHI on 03/16/2016. To the extent that this Court has dismissed any claim without prejudice, th is Court will allow Plaintiff to file a motion for leave to file an amended complaint. Plaintiff must attach a copy of his proposed amended complaint to the motion for leave to file an amended complaint. See Local Rule LR10.3 ("Any party filing or moving to file an amended complaint... shall reproduce the entire pleading as amended and may not incorporate any part of a prior pleading by reference, except with leave of court."). This Court ORDERS Plaintiff to file his motion for leave t o file an amended complaint by May 2, 2016. The motion will be referred to the magistrate judge. This Court CAUTIONS Plaintiff that, if he fails to file his motion for leave to file an amended complaint by May 2, 2016, all of the claims that this Court dismissed without prejudice in this Order will be dismissed with prejudice, and this Court will direct the Clerk's Office to issue the final judgment and close the case. In other words, Plaintiff would have no remaining claims in this case. This Court also CAUTIONS Plaintiff that,even if the magistrate allows Plaintiff to file his proposed amended complaint, as to any claim that this Order dismissed without prejudice, the corresponding amended claim may be dismissed with prejudic e if the amended claim fails to cure the defects identified in this Order.
